W01fman Radio shack has a PS2 to USB adapter. Item 26-729. Cost me $11.99. It came with a driver cd for an easy install. I'm been playing Frets on Fire like crazy and it works great for my wireless gitar hero controller.

Are there any good PC controllers for playing Genesis ROMs?

I'm looking for a controller that actually has a good D-pad with directional buttons that aren't webbed together (like that X-Box 360 did), and resembles either a PS/PS2 or SNES controller. Considering I'm not big on PC gaming as far as newer games go, Im not looking for something too expensive. I just need a good controller to play NES or Genesis ROMs.
